The setup method for the Highlander's auto start-stop function is as follows: 1. The Highlander's start-stop switch (Auto Stop and Start System switch) is located on the left side of the steering wheel. Press the Stop and Start Cancel button (press again to re-enable the system) to disable the Stop and Start system, and the instrument panel will display accordingly. 2. When the auto start-stop system is still active, do not place the vehicle in a poorly ventilated area. The engine will automatically restart. 3. When the windows fog up, press the cancel button, and then the auto start-stop system will no longer function. 4. If the gear lever is moved from neutral to another gear without depressing the clutch pedal, the engine will not restart, and the buzzer will sound. In this case, return the gear lever to neutral.
